Sound waves aimed at the brain could quiet tics without surgery
NCT ID NCT07699783
First seen Jul 13, 2026 · Last updated Jul 14, 2026 · Updated 1 time
Summary
This phase 1 trial tests whether low-energy focused ultrasound can safely and temporarily reduce tics in people with Tourette syndrome. Twenty participants aged 16 and older receive ultrasound to deep brain regions or the motor cortex, or a sham treatment, across four sessions. The goal is to see if this non-invasive approach can modulate the brain circuits involved in tic generation.

- What this could lead to
- If successful, this could offer a non-invasive, precise way to reduce tics in Tourette syndrome without surgery or medication.
- What could go wrong
- This is an early phase 1 trial with only 20 participants, so results may not apply broadly. The effects are temporary (up to 60 minutes) and the approach is highly technical, requiring exact targeting.

Show the full entry requirements Hide the full entry requirements
Copied word for word from the study's registry entry, so the wording is the study team's rather than ours.
Inclusion Criteria: * Diagnosis of Tourette Syndrome according to DSM-5 criteria * a total motor or vocal tic severity sub-score of at least 15, or a total tic severity score greater than 22 on the Yale Global Tic Severity Rating Scale (YGTSS) * a stable medication regimen during the 3 months prior, clinically stable in any psychiatric comorbidities Exclusion Criteria: * Contraindications for MRI
